Motorcyclist Killed After Colliding With Hit and Run DUI Driver’s Truck

The Florida Highway Patrol (FHP) continues to investigate a crash that killed a motorcyclist from Brandon, Florida.

The crash occurred at approximately 1:45 a.m. on Friday, February 22, 2019 in the eastbound lanes of I-4 east of SR-574.

The motorcyclist, 23 year-old Andy Sanford of Brandon, was traveling eastbound in the inside lane on a 2010 Harley Davidson motorcycle. He was behind a 2018 Dodge Ram truck driven by 39 year-old Johnathon Thompson of Ft. Lauderdale.

According to troopers, Sanford attempted to overtake Thompson’s truck and collided with the rear of the truck.

Following the crash, Thomspon left the scene and traveled north on I-75 then turned back southbound on I-75 until stopped by FHP troopers near milepost 268.

Thompson was arrested for leaving the scene of the crash, driving with suspended license, and DUI.

Sanford, who was not wearing a helmet, was transported to Tampa General Hospital where he died from his injuries.
